Abstract
The invention discloses a kind of broadcasting and TV new media operation systems and the communication means of front-end business collecting system, comprise the steps of:A, the broadcasting and TV new media operation system based on unilateral network and bilateral network is created, establishes the unilateral network access between operation system and broadcasting and TV front-end business collecting system;B, the communication means between operation system and collecting system relies on the encapsulation based on XML data format.Concrete operation step:Operation system completes the assembly for business datum;Assembled XML data is carried out HTML dynamics to splice, the splicing of the template of HTML is completed, forms the prototype of file publishing.The beneficial effects of the invention are as follows:1)For broadcasting and TV new media operation system docking rule has been worked out with docking for broadcasting and TV front-end business collecting system.2)Data assembling is carried out with XML data format and has done good ductility and expansion for the access of platform.3)Agreement component independently causes the update for data more targeted and convenience.

Background technology
1st, extensible markup language(XML)With Access, the databases such as Oracle with SQL Server are different, and database carries
More strong data storage and analysis ability have been supplied, such as:Data directory, sequence, lookup, relevant coherency etc., the ancestor of XML
Purport transmission data, and belong to the HTML of standard generalized markup language together with it and be mainly used for display data.In fact XML and other
Data representation it is maximum be not both:He is extremely simple.This is one and seems the advantages of somewhat trifling, but is exactly that this point makes
XML is unusual.
The simple of XML makes it easier to read and write data in any application program, this makes XML be quickly become data exchange only
One common language, although different application software also supports other data interchange formats, in the near future they will support
XML, that means that program can be easier with Windows, Mac OS, the information generated under Linux and other platforms
With reference to then being easy to load XML data into program and analyze him, and export result in xml format.
2nd, the content to be issued to each increment service system in front end of service convergence layout auditing system carry out layout, examination & verification,
Management.Including channel lineup auditing system, patch layout auditing system.Wherein channel lineup auditing system is to channel type
Value-added service(Such as electric business operation system, government affairs information operation system)The layout and examination & verification to release news manages;Patch layout
Auditing system is the increment service system to patch type(Such as:Advertisement, EPG operation systems etc.)The layout and examination & verification to release news
Management.
Main function has business channels management, content resource management and examination & verification management, is equivalent to new media operation system
Service convergence system.
The rapid development of modern society's Internet technology, business and service for traditional broadcasting and TV unilateral network generate huge
Big impact.New media using the innovation industry situation such as e-commerce, virtual community as representative emerges in an endless stream, and produces in social life
Raw more and more great influence.New media has the strong feature of data structure variation and business form Two-way, to passing
System one-way network system generates stern challenge.By taking radio and television as an example, operation system will not only support traditional audio and video number
According to type, also want what can be carried the data types such as picture, word, webpage, micro- video and be generated due to the evolution of big data
More data type;User is no longer simply to watch simultaneously, it is necessary to support the participation of user, i.e. the timely of user's client information is returned
It passes.This is all the demand that traditional broadcast television one-way system is difficult to realize, therefore, it is necessary to find adequate solution scheme
The application of internet, which is directly involved in CHINA RFTCOM Co Ltd, theoretically to realize, but based on broadcasting network relative closure
And unidirectional characteristic, how so that the E-business applications on internet are preferably broadcasting and TV service, more internets are believed
In the service for extending to radio, TV and film industries of breath health just, it is therefore desirable to a kind of by broadcasting and TV new media service access to CHINA RFTCOM Co Ltd
In, realize the communication of data.
